NEW DELHI: The Army should continue to maintain operational readiness at its “peak level”, defence minister Rajnath Singh said on Wednesday, in the backdrop of India and China keeping their troops forward deployed for the third consecutive winter along the frontier in eastern Ladakh.
Interacting with top generals during the Army commanders’ conference here, Singh said he had experienced first-hand the high standard of operational preparedness of the 12-lakh force while visiting forward areas. “We ought to be prepared for any operational contingencies. I have full confidence in the Indian Army and its leadership,” he said.
The five-day conference led by General Manoj Pande, which began on Monday, is undertaking a comprehensive review of the operational situation, combat readiness and infrastructure development along the frontiers with China and Pakistan as well as modernisation plans through indigenisation and human resource management.
Apart from Chief of Defence Staff Gen Anil Chauhan, IAF and Navy chiefs, a former top diplomat as well as a retired R&AW officer are slated to talk on “Contemporary India-China relations” and “Technological Challenges for National Security” during the conference.
